BD302N THRU BD302P 30 AMP BLOCK DIODES FEATURES ..High current capability ..High voltage available ..Glass passivated die construction ..High surge current capability .30A 125℃,. 30Ampere Operation At TL=125℃ With No Thermal Runaway MECHANICAL DATA .BD302N BD302-N N-Lead ,P-Case BLOCK DIODE .BD302P BD302-P P-Lead ,N-Case Dimension in millimeters TA= 25℃. ,,60HZ,., 20% MAXIMUM RATINGS AND ELECTRICAL CHARACTERISTICS Rating at 25℃ Ambient temp. Unless otherwise specified.Single phase, half sine wave, 60HZ,resistive or inductive load.
